个人简短小结
在此次项目中,我的主要角色是客户经理、go工程师。在项目伊始我们就对项目进行了明确的分工,我主要负责项目后端设计。因为我负责的是项目后端部分,所以前期一直在等前端的成员完成UI部分设计,同时进行项目的一些前期调研。在中期,我开始阅读前端、服务器端代码,完成一些后端逻辑处理,利用Go+Goland编写后端代码。在项目后期,我开始分担编写文档的工作,完成部分项目文档的编写。也许是因为交流不够,我们组员出现了工作重复的情况,很可惜浪费掉了部分组员的努力。
P2P2.1统计
PSP 2.1 | Personal Software Process Stages | 16340160 |
---|---|---|
Planning | 计划 | 10 |
estimate | 预估任务时间 | 10 |
Development | 开发 | 80 |
analysis | 需求分析 | 10 |
design spec | 生成设计文档 | 5 |
estimate | 设计复审(与前端团队成员审核设计文档) | 5 |
coding standard | 代码规范 | 2 |
design | 具体设计,包括绘制 UI,设计架构等 | 10 |
coding | 具体编码 | 25 |
code review | 代码复审 | 8 |
test | 测试(修改代码) | 15 |
Report | 报告 | 10 |
test report | 测试报告 | 2 |
size measurement | 计算工作量 | 1 |
postmortem & process improvement plan | 每次迭代结束后写总结文档,并提出改进计划 | 7 |
主要工作清单
- 最得意: 因为编写后端代码需要理解前端的一些设计,所以除了后端知识的学习,还了解到一点小程序前端的设计。
- 最有价值: 在编写后端代码时,学习到了很多硬核知识,比如说微信小程序的登陆机制、支付机制。
- 最有苦劳:在合作没什么苦劳,努力为项目做贡献都是应该的。
个人GIT总结:
Dashboard 文档集合
Back-End-Go 后端代码
个人博客清单
特别致谢:
非常感谢每一个小组成员的努力付出,大家都很认真努力地完成了自己的那一部分,努力地为项目做贡献。很开心能和全部小组成员顺利地完成这一次项目。